Bathroom Fan Repair in Alpharetta, GA
Bathroom fan repair services address issues related to ventilation systems in residential bathrooms. This includes fixing or replacing malfunctioning fans that may be noisy, failing to turn on, or not effectively exhausting moisture and odors. Projects can range from simple repairs of a broken switch or wiring to complete replacements of outdated or damaged fans. Homeowners often seek this service to improve air quality, prevent mold growth, and maintain a comfortable bathroom environment.
Before requesting bathroom fan repair, property owners typically want to understand the cause of the problem, the compatibility of replacement units, and the scope of work involved. It's helpful to have details about the fan's brand, model, and the specific issues experienced. Clarifying whether the repair involves electrical work or duct modifications can also assist in planning the project. Proper assessment ensures the ventilation system functions efficiently and meets the needs of the household.

Bathroom Fan Repair Questions
Why is my bathroom fan not turning on? The fan may have a faulty switch, a blown fuse, or wiring issues that prevent it from operating properly.
How can I tell if my bathroom fan needs repair? Signs include persistent noise, reduced airflow, or the fan not turning on at all, indicating possible motor or wiring problems.
What causes bathroom fans to stop working? Common causes include dust buildup, motor failure, or electrical connections becoming loose over time.
Is it necessary to replace a broken bathroom fan? Repair may be possible if the issue is minor, but replacement is often recommended for significant motor or wiring problems.
